To find the best fertility center for you, require time to research any center you consider. Do not just pick the first place that returns your call; pursuing fertility testing and treatment is a big step and can likewise include huge money and great deals of time. You wish to choose only the best.

The finest clinic for your good friend might or might not be the very best for you. So ask your pals, doctor, insurance business, and local support system for suggestions, however be sure to examine any center you consider yourself. On their sites On the CDC's fertility clinic data report page (more on that below) On the Society for Assisted Reproductive Innovation site (includes outcome stats for clinics) By speaking to a clinic representative over the phone or personally By consulting with current or previous clients (found through local infertility support system) By meeting and interviewing your prospective doctor at an assessment A fertility center is only as great as its doctors.

There are advantages and downsides to both setups, however usually, you want one doctor as your main contact and case supervisor. Concerns to think about when choosing a physician are: If they aren't prepared to consult with you prior to you pick them, then they may not have time for you when you're a client.



The longer people stick with the clinic, the most likely the workplace runs smoothly (fertility treatments near me). Will your case be dealt with by one doctor or a team, and who will you see on your gos to? If your case is made complex, having a team can be helpful. On the other hand, requiring to deal with a various medical professional at every visit can feel impersonal. best fertility centers.

They must be able to address your concerns about charges and payment strategies, and you should sit down to discuss your choices and ask questions on your first check out to the clinic. It might feel odd to be considering price when taking a look at centers, however thinking about the fee is almost important. fertility company.

Questions to think about concerning financing include: And will staff manage insurance coverage claims? If not, will they provide you with the needed documents to pursue insurance protection on your own? Are any tests or treatments covered by your insurance? And what do the quoted prices include? For example, when pricing estimate the price for IVF, does that consist of medications and tracking? Embryo storage!.?.!? If not, what can you anticipate the overall fee? Will you have to pay anything in advance? How much? If you're doing IVF, what do you pay if your cycle is canceled before egg retrieval!.?. ivf clinic usa.!? What if it's canceled prior to embryo transfer? Does the center deal with any national infertility financing programs, like the Attain Fertility Centers network or the ARC Fertility Program? Do any physicians or personnel members receive kickbacks or financial incentives if you sign up with a certain fertility financing programs? (If yes, be additional mindful that the finance program is genuinely the very best option.) These are programs that require a large in advance cost but assure some of your refund if you do not get pregnant after a set variety of cycles.

Ensure the refund program allows you a state in how lots of embryos are moved and allows you time to take a break between cycles (more than just one month) to recover physically and emotionally. Another crucial element to think about is the clinic's success rate.

Having the highest success rate does not necessarily indicate the center is the very best. Some centers avoid taking on tough cases or refuse treatment to ladies above age 40 with their own eggs. This can obviously skew the statistics. What you should be trying to find is: are the clinic's success rates higher than the nationwide average? (Take a look at the national IVF success rates here.) You should take a look at the live birth data for your age, and not simply the pregnancy data (which will consist of miscarriages).

If you're refraining from doing IVF, inquire about the live birth success rates particular to your circumstance and particular to the treatments being suggested. (Bear in mind that only IVF success rates are reported to SART and the CDC, so for other treatment success rates, you'll require to ask your physician.) Your doctor needs to have the experience to help you choose if the treatments deserve the financial and emotional investment.

There's no such thing as a 100% assurance with IVF, no matter what factor for your infertility (infertility clinic).

This includes success numbers of every treatment from IVF and IUI to embryo transfers. According to the CDC, in 2017 there were a total of 448 centers that reported information to them. That is a frustrating number, however the CDC has actually created a user-friendly interactive map that allows you to browse by location for stats on centers in your location.

To narrow down your outcomes, you can click your state, or search by postal code and radius surrounding it. Depending on your state, you might have more clinics in a more focused distance. From here, the tool will reveal you the clinics within the specifications you have actually set, noting the clinic name in addition to address and telephone number. ivf clinics near me.

Once you have actually selected your clinic, it will pull up a profile with particular tabbed classifications for you to browse under. This the first tab which lists the clinic's place information and its Medical Director, in addition to two columns about the services that center offers and the clinic's summary for the last documented year's ART.
